Analysing Task Audit, Data Audit and Process Flow History
Hi,
Internal Audit dept has requested a bunch of information, that we need to compile from Task Audit, Data Audit and Process Flow History logs. We do have all the info available, however not in a format that allows proper "reporting" of log information. What is the best way to handle HFM logs so that we can quickly filter and export required audit information?
We do have housekeeping in place, so the logs are partial "live" db tables, and partial purged tables that were exported to Excel to archive the historical log info.
Many Thanks.I thought I posted this Friday, but I just noticed I never hit the 'Post Message Button', ha ha.
This info below will help you translate some of the information in the tables, etc. You could report on it from the Audit tables directly or move them to another appropriate data table for analysis later. The concensus, though I disagree, is that you will suffer performance issues if your audit tables get too big, so you want to move them periodically. You can do this using a scheduled Task, manual process, etc.
I personally just dump it to another table and report on it from there. As mentioned above, you'll need to translate some of the information as it is not 'human readable' in the database.
For instance, if I wanted to pull Metadata Load, Rules Load, Member List load, you could run a query like this. (NOTE: strAppName should be equal to the name of your application .... )
The main tricks to know at least for task audit table are figuring out how to convert times and determing which activity code corresponds to the user friendly name.
-- Declare working variables --
declare @dtStartDate as nvarchar(20)
declare @dtEndDate as nvarchar(20)
declare @strAppName as nvarchar(20)
declare @strSQL as nvarchar(4000)
-- Initialize working variables --
set @dtStartDate = '1/1/2012'
set @dtEndDate = '8/31/2012'
set @strAppName = 'YourAppNameHere'
--Get Rules Load, Metadata, Member List
set @strSQL = '
select sUserName as "User", ''Rules Load'' as Activity, c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) as "Time Start",
cast(EndTime-2 as smalldatetime) as ''Time End'', ServerName, strDescription, strModuleName
from ' + @strAppName + '_task_audit ta, hsv_activity_users au
where au.lUserID = ta.ActivityUserID and activitycode in (1)
and c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) between ''' + @dtStartDate + ''' and ''' + @dtEndDate + '''
union all
select sUserName as "User", ''Metadata Load'' as Activity, c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) as "Time Start",
cast(EndTime-2 as smalldatetime) as ''Time End'', ServerName, strDescription, strModuleName
from ' + @strAppName + '_task_audit ta, hsv_activity_users au
where au.lUserID = ta.ActivityUserID and activitycode in (21)
and c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) between ''' + @dtStartDate + ''' and ''' + @dtEndDate + '''
union all
select sUserName as "User", ''Memberlist Load'' as Activity, c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) as "Time Start",
cast(EndTime-2 as smalldatetime) as ''Time End'', ServerName, strDescription, strModuleName
from ' + @strAppName + '_task_audit ta, hsv_activity_users au
where au.lUserID = ta.ActivityUserID and activitycode in (23)
and cast(StartTime-2 as smalldatetime) between ''' + @dtStartDate + ''' and ''' + @dtEndDate + ''''
exec sp_executesql @strSQLIn regards to activity codes, here's a quick breakdown on those ....
ActivityID ActivityName
0 Idle
1 Rules Load
2 Rules Scan
3 Rules Extract
4 Consolidation
5 Chart Logic
6 Translation
7 Custom Logic
8 Allocate
9 Data Load
10 Data Extract
11 Data Extract via HAL
12 Data Entry
13 Data Retrieval
14 Data Clear
15 Data Copy
16 Journal Entry
17 Journal Retrieval
18 Journal Posting
19 Journal Unposting
20 Journal Template Entry
21 Metadata Load
22 Metadata Extract
23 Member List Load
24 Member List Scan
25 Member List Extract
26 Security Load
27 Security Scan
28 Security Extract
29 Logon
30 Logon Failure
31 Logoff
32 External
33 Metadata Scan
34 Data Scan
35 Extended Analytics Export
36 Extended Analytics Schema Delete
37 Transactions Load
38 Transactions Extract
39 Document Attachments
40 Document Detachments
41 Create Transactions
42 Edit Transactions
43 Delete Transactions
44 Post Transactions
45 Unpost Transactions
46 Delete Invalid Records
47 Data Audit Purged
48 Task Audit Purged
49 Post All Transactions
50 Unpost All Transactions
51 Delete All Transactions
52 Unmatch All Transactions
53 Auto Match by ID
54 Auto Match by Account
55 Intercompany Matching Report by ID
56 Intercompany Matching Report by Acct
57 Intercompany Transaction Report
58 Manual Match
59 Unmatch Selected
60 Manage IC Periods
61 Lock/Unlock IC Entities
62 Manage IC Reason Codes

Standard Inport Package is getting failed at Convert Data Task
Hi All,
When running standard import package on any application, it's getting failed at Convert Data Task.
Do any body faced similar kind of issue, please let me know what might be the cause or any solution to the above issue would be appreciated.
Regards,
Sreekanth.Hi,
The format of dimension members in the external file is different from the BPC internal format. Check your conversion file. The problem is with your conversion file.
For example:
In the external file Time dimension values is given as Jan, Feb, Mar etc..
In BPC asume you are maintaining time dimension members as 2008.Jan, 2008.Feb etc.
Then you should define this in conversion file. Jan should be replaced by 2008.Jan when it enter BPC application. Also, the values you define in the Internal format should be maintained as master data (dimension members).
